Output eeabe3fd99ab40d0e19aa5870fe34a36bf841bab29e92c87ee53e4dcf0fee20e:43

value
500837
script pubkey
OP_0 OP_PUSHBYTES_20 567af772b4cf163cd761add1e44395a42f7068d2
address
tb1q2ea0wu45eutre4mp4hg7gsu45shhq6xj0cmh3s
transaction
eeabe3fd99ab40d0e19aa5870fe34a36bf841bab29e92c87ee53e4dcf0fee20e
confirmations
8562
spent
false

1 Sat Range